I bought my prom dress from a thrift store for just \$12. I was hoping for something affordable and pretty — but what I found tucked into the dress lining wasn’t just fabric. It was a handwritten letter. And that letter would quietly change the lives of three people.
I’ve always been the quiet one — the girl who gets good grades, keeps her head down, and hears teachers whisper that she’s “going places.” But I also knew that dreams take more than words. Sitting in our small kitchen while my mom counted grocery money, I learned early that doing your best doesn’t always make life easy.
Dad left when I was seven. One morning, he was there; the next, he wasn’t. Since then, it had been just me, Mom, and Grandma in a house filled with secondhand furniture, mismatched dishes, and memories we held onto tightly.
Still, we made it work. Somehow, love filled the spaces that money couldn’t.
So when prom season rolled around, I didn’t ask about a dress. I knew Mom would try if she could — and I didn’t want her to carry that weight.
But Grandma had other plans. She had a way of turning hard times into little adventures.
“You’d be amazed what people give away,” she said with a wink. “Let’s go treasure hunting.”
That’s what she called thrift shopping — “treasure hunting.” And on a rainy Thursday afternoon, that’s exactly what we did.
The downtown Goodwill smelled like aged books and forgotten memories. Grandma led me straight to the formalwear rack, her fingers grazing each dress like she was searching for something only she could see.
Many of the dresses looked outdated or overly worn. But then I saw it — a floor-length gown in deep navy blue, with lace along the back and a gentle shimmer when it caught the light.
“Grandma,” I whispered, “look.”
Her eyes widened. “Well, would you look at that?”
It was priced at just \$12.
Back home, Grandma carefully examined the dress. She’d been altering clothes most of her life, and her hands moved with confidence and care. But as she looked closer, she noticed a section of stitching that didn’t quite match the rest.
“Hand me the seam ripper,” she said.
I leaned in to help and felt something crinkle beneath the lining.
“What’s that?” Grandma asked, surprised.
I carefully opened a small hidden seam — and pulled out a folded note.
“Ellie,” I read aloud. “I’m sending you this dress for your prom. It’s my way of asking for your forgiveness.”
I stopped. My throat tightened as I continued.
“I had to make a difficult choice when you were five. I truly believed someone else could give you a better life. But I’ve thought about you every day since. If you ever want to find me, my address is at the bottom of this letter. I love you — Mom.”
The handwriting trembled with emotion.
Grandma and I looked at each other. This wasn’t just any dress — this was a message meant for someone named Ellie, hidden and lost in time.
“We need to find her,” I said.
We tried. I returned to the store the next morning, hoping for some kind of lead.
“That dress?” the woman at the counter said. “It’s been here over two years. Donated without a name.”
My heart sank. How do you find someone when all you have is a first name?
Still, prom was coming up, and Grandma had poured so much love into making the dress fit perfectly. So I wore it.
And that night was magic.
The dress shimmered under the lights. I felt like I belonged. When they announced my name for prom queen, I nearly didn’t believe it. Me — the girl who almost didn’t go.
Afterward, my literature teacher approached me, smiling warmly.
“Cindy,” she said, “may I ask where you found that dress?”
“A thrift store,” I replied.
She laughed softly. “I thought so. It looks exactly like the one I wore to my own prom. Funny, right?”
“Wait,” I said, suddenly breathless. “What’s your first name?”
“Eleanor,” she said. “But my family always called me Ellie.”
I froze. “Ellie?” I whispered.
She looked puzzled. “Yes… why?”
I couldn’t believe it. “Please — I need to show you something.”
She followed me home, quietly curious. I handed her the note, now smoothed and safely tucked away.
She read it. Her eyes welled with tears.
“This… this was for me,” she whispered. “She came back… I just never knew.”
She pulled me into a hug, full of gratitude and wonder. “You were meant to find this,” she said.
The next morning, we made the drive together — six hours to the address written at the bottom of that note. The small white house looked like something from a postcard. We sat in the car, nerves making the air feel still and heavy.
“What if she’s not there?” Ellie asked.
“What if she is?” I replied.
When she knocked, an older woman answered. She blinked, stunned.
“Ellie?” she said, barely a whisper.
Then they embraced. Years of silence melted away in a single, tearful moment.
Inside, we sat at her kitchen table. There was tea, there were stories, and there were long, quiet pauses that said more than words ever could.
Before we left, Ellie’s mother handed me an envelope.
“You brought my daughter back into my life,” she said. “Please let us do something for you.”
Inside was a check — enough to help cover everything my scholarship didn’t.
I tried to say no, but Ellie took my hand.
“You helped bring us back together,” she said. “Please let us help you move forward.”
That gift changed everything. I could finally study without worry. I could build something stable, something lasting.
That \$12 dress turned out to be more than just a gown — it was a thread connecting the past and the future.
And every time I look back, I hear Grandma’s voice:
“You’d be surprised what people give away.”
She was right.
Sometimes, what we leave behind becomes someone else’s treasure — and sometimes, that treasure leads straight to the heart.
**If this story moved you, consider sharing it. You never know who might need the reminder: second chances can be hidden in the most unexpected places.**